SUMMARY

Probably no other region in the world possesses as many symbols for water as East and Southeast Asia, particularly Siam. Aquatic images and attributes abound in a wide range of human pursuits, from ritual, literature, dancing, and art, to architecture and town planning. This book explains these symbols while relating them to the origin of civilizations in the area. A revised edition of Jumsai's 1982 study of Thai cultural origins, this volume incorporates original ideas and important contributions by R.
